Simple Resolution
A form of legislative measure introduced and potentially acted upon by only one congressional chamber and used for the regulation of business only within the chamber of origin. Depending on the chamber of origin, they begin with a designation of either H.Res. or S.Res. Joint resolutions and concurrent resolutions are other types of resolutions.

Summary

This resolution expresses support for the goals of the International Decade for People of African Descent and calls on the United States, in cooperation with African descent communities and organizations, to develop strategies to combat racism domestically and globally.
